Maryland Day Filled WIth Pomp and Ceremony
HISTORIC ST. MARY'S CITY - 4/1/2009
|
On Sunday, March 29, from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m., Historic St. Mary’s City at the State House was host to a celebration of Maryland’s heritage. The day, featured a lot of pageantry, wreath-laying, speeches, and Ceremony of the Flags; with fourth-grade students from Maryland counties presenting their jurisdiction's colors. Governor Martin O'Malley was the keynote speaker for this special anniversary celebration. Bear Creek BBQ and Bailey's Catering fed the crowd and provided refreshments.
